Martin Jerisat

Of Counsel
Phone 323-850-1900

Martin started his career as a patent lawyer, given his engineering background and experience, specializing in drafting patent applications in various technologies and infringement litigation.

He worked for few years for various firms in Florida.

He then moved to Chicago and started his trial career by joining the office of the public defender of Cook County where he tried many misdemeanors and felony cases for several years. He then moved to civil practice where he practiced commercial and intellectual property litigation in Chicago.

He then moved to California and joined a tobacco company as its inhouse counsel managing its global litigation and legal department. He left his corporate position to focus on civil trials to represent victims of negligence and corporate greed. He has tried numerous civil cases and recovered millions for his clients.

He has a unique background including engineering degree, masters in social science and law, and pharmaceutical chemistry. This background allows him to analyze complex cases involving medical and engineering issues. He is a member of honor societies in political science and pharmacology.

He attended CAALA Plaintiff’s Trial Academy in Los Angeles, California, and Jerry Spence Trial Lawyers’ College in Wyoming. He is licensed in Illinois and California.
